#954d08 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#954d08 is composed of 58.4% red, 30.2%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.3% magenta, 94.6%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 29.4 degrees, a saturation of 89.8% and a lightness of 30.8%. #954d08 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ff9a10 with #2b0000. Closest websafe color is: #996600.

Shades and Tints of #954d08

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#fef5ec is the lightest one.

Tones of #954d08

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#534e4a is the less saturated color, while #9b4d02 is the most saturated one.
